From 75ec42320df4af879ff4fb54938046e46c4895fd Mon Sep 17 00:00:00 2001 From: Ed Schouten Date: Thu, 24 Jul 2008 09:54:10 +0000 Subject: [PATCH] Don't include in non-TTY drivers. The kbd, kbdmux, ugen and uhid drivers included , because they needed clists, which have been moved to some time ago. In the MPSAFE TTY branch, does not include , which means we have to teach these drivers to include this header file directly. Approved by: philip (mentor, implicit) --- sys/dev/kbd/kbd.c | 3 ++- sys/dev/kbdmux/kbdmux.c | 2 +- sys/dev/usb/ugen.c | 2 +- sys/dev/usb/uhid.c | 3 ++- 4 files changed, 6 insertions(+), 4 deletions(-) diff --git a/sys/dev/kbd/kbd.c b/sys/dev/kbd/kbd.c index 15a3e221996..53b118d0bfa 100644 --- a/sys/dev/kbd/kbd.c +++ b/sys/dev/kbd/kbd.c @@ -34,12 +34,13 @@ __FBSDID("$FreeBSD$"); #include #include #include +#include #include #include -#include #include #include #include +#include #include #include diff --git a/sys/dev/kbdmux/kbdmux.c b/sys/dev/kbdmux/kbdmux.c index 7be985829a1..3ece059806a 100644 --- a/sys/dev/kbdmux/kbdmux.c +++ b/sys/dev/kbdmux/kbdmux.c @@ -36,6 +36,7 @@ #include #include +#include #include #include #include @@ -52,7 +53,6 @@ #include #include #include -#include #include #include #include diff --git a/sys/dev/usb/ugen.c b/sys/dev/usb/ugen.c index a63422feb30..48569199321 100644 --- a/sys/dev/usb/ugen.c +++ b/sys/dev/usb/ugen.c @@ -50,6 +50,7 @@ __FBSDID("$FreeBSD$"); #include #include +#include #include #include #include @@ -58,7 +59,6 @@ __FBSDID("$FreeBSD$"); #include #include #include -#include #include #include #include diff --git a/sys/dev/usb/uhid.c b/sys/dev/usb/uhid.c index 2a33cb321f1..44e834932ca 100644 --- a/sys/dev/usb/uhid.c +++ b/sys/dev/usb/uhid.c @@ -55,6 +55,7 @@ __FBSDID("$FreeBSD$"); #include #include +#include #include #include #include @@ -67,11 +68,11 @@ __FBSDID("$FreeBSD$"); #include #include #include -#include #include #include #include #include +#include #include #include